Optimal Timing for Spearmint Tea Consumption

Timing is crucial when it comes to maximizing the health benefits of spearmint tea. While some might enjoy a cup first thing in the morning to kickstart their day, others may prefer a soothing drink in the evening to unwind. The key point here is moderation; it’s often recommended to drink between two to three cups daily. This frequency allows your body to absorb the beneficial properties of spearmint while keeping it on the lighter side so that you don’t overdo it. If you are considering specific benefits, like hormone regulation or digestive aid, this frequency can also be adaptable based on personal needs.

Spearmint Tea for Hormonal Balance

One of the significant claims made about spearmint tea is its potential to promote hormonal balance, particularly in women suffering from conditions like pol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S). For those looking to manage symptoms related to hormonal imbalances, drinking spearmint tea could be beneficial. Recommendations suggest consuming this herbal beverage around two cups daily for effective results in reducing androgen levels, which can assist in clearing the skin of acne and excessive hair growth. However, consistency is key; integrating this into your routine can create noticeable changes over time.

Potential Side Effects and Considerations

Although spearmint tea offers many health benefits, there are a few considerations worth noting. Individuals who are pregnant or breastfeeding should consult with a healthcare provider before indulging too much in spearmint tea. Additionally, while uncommon, excessive consumption could lead to gastrointestinal discomfort. Therefore, keeping the intake to a couple of cups per day can be an excellent rule of thumb. Balancing your tea drinking with water and other sources of hydration also ensures you’re not overwhelming your system.
